Output 0628fa3456c12b1050e5251e5ae7640978ee3049d3696b4dbd760eaaa5a1dcbb:1

value
432373863
script pubkey
OP_0 OP_PUSHBYTES_20 85c51281819ef249aa2e1ea08b1490d28a0e4dd5
address
bc1qshz39qvpnmeyn23wr6sgk9ys629qunw4dv0lj9
transaction
0628fa3456c12b1050e5251e5ae7640978ee3049d3696b4dbd760eaaa5a1dcbb
confirmations
414814
spent
true